📣 Notas para viajantes

Portugal is a hospitable country known for its beautiful beaches, cuisine, historical sites, and warm summers. Travelers can engage in diverse activities, from surfing in Nazaré and visiting historical sites to experiencing religious pilgrimages in Fátima and skiing in Serra da Estrela during winter.

  • Major local events often include 'Marchas Populares' (street parades) in Lisbon and Porto.
  • Traditional parish festivals frequently feature religious processions, local dress, and fireworks.
  • Seasonal celebrations include the Festival do Sudoeste on the southwest coast and regional fairs.
  • Tourists should check official tourist board websites for current, comprehensive event details.
  • When visiting churches and religious sites, dress modestly and maintain quiet respect. While Portugal is largely secular, Catholic traditions remain strong, necessitating respect for local customs, especially in rural areas. Note that smoking is prohibited in most indoor public and transport areas.
